The German health authorities
reported
6729
new corona infections to
the Robert Koch Institute (RKI)
within one day.
In addition,
217
new deaths were recorded within 24 hours, as the RKI announced on Monday morning.
Last Monday there were 7141 new infections and 214 new deaths, but at that time the data from Rhineland-Palatinate was only incomplete.
The number of cases recorded is usually lower on Mondays, among other things because fewer tests are carried out on the weekend.

The high of 1,244 new deaths was reached on January 14th.
In the case of new infections registered within 24 hours, the highest value was reported on December 18, at 33,777 - but this contained 3500 late reports.

The number of new infections reported within seven days per 100,000 inhabitants (seven-day incidence) was
111.2
on Monday morning, according to the RKI
.
Its previous high was reached on December 22nd at
197.6
.
The number fluctuated after that and has been falling again for a few days.

The RKI has counted
2,141,665
detected infections with Sars-CoV-2 in Germany
since the beginning of the pandemic
(as of January 25, 00:00 a.m.).
The actual total number is likely to be significantly higher since many infections are not recognized.
The total number of people who died with or with a proven infection with Sars-CoV-2 rose to
52,087
.
The RKI
stated the
number of
people recovered
to be
around
1,823,500
.

According to the RKI situation report on Sunday evening, the nationwide seven-day R-value was
1.01
(previous day also
1.01
).
This means that 100 infected people theoretically infect 101 more people.
The value represents the occurrence of the infection 8 to 16 days ago.
If it is below 1 for a long time, the infection process subsides.
USA and Spain - German government classifies 25 countries as "high-risk areas"
display
Because of the particularly high number of corona infections, the federal government has been classifying
25 countries
as high-risk areas for the
first time since Sunday
, for which even stricter entry rules apply than for the previous and still existing "risk areas".
The list can be found on the RKI website: This includes the Czech Republic, Portugal, Spain and Egypt, Israel, Iran, the United Arab Emirates, Lebanon and the USA.
Entry from these "high incidence areas" is only possible with a negative corona test.
The test may have been carried out at least 48 hours before entry.
In addition, as with the countries classified as "risk areas", those entering the country have to go into a ten-day quarantine.
The Greek region of Attica around the capital Athens, on the other hand, is one of the very few European regions no longer considered a risk area - if you travel from there to Germany, no quarantine is necessary.

The front runner in vaccinations in Germany is
Mecklenburg-Western Pomerania
with a vaccination rate of
2.76 percent of
the population, followed by
Schleswig-Holstein
with
2.59 percent
.
Baden-Württemberg comes in last with a rate of 1.22 percent.

In
New Zealand
,
known for its successful fight against the corona pandemic
, a locally transmitted case of infection has been confirmed for the first time since November.
The health authorities in the island nation in the South Pacific announced that it was a 56-year-old woman who stayed in a quarantine hotel in Auckland for two weeks after returning from Europe.
There she was tested negative for the virus twice.
It was only after she returned to her home region of Northland on the North Island that she showed symptoms and tested positive, it said.
The virus is the new, more contagious virus mutation from South Africa, confirmed the Minister for Covid-19 Control, Chris Hipkins.
The woman apparently got infected from another person in the quarantine hotel.
China
reports 124 new infections for Sunday after 80 one day earlier.
67 of the new cases were recorded in northeastern Jilin Province, official data suggests.

In
Russia
, the authorities registered fewer than 20,000 new infections in one day for the first time since November 11th. 19,290 people tested positive for the corona virus, including just under 2,400 in Moscow, it said on Monday. In total, more than 3.73 million cases of infection were recorded, making Russia fourth in the world behind the USA, India and Brazil. In addition, the number of deaths related to the virus rose within 24 hours by 456 to 69,918.
